Carnarvon Station was a cattle station for 140 years and was purchased by Bush Heritage and turned into a Conservation Reserve.
Abutting Queensland's Carnarvon Gorge National Park, this is one of the few remaining strongholds for woodland species largely lost to the rest of eastern Australia.
